CVE-2021-33528

WEIDMUELLER: WLAN devices affected by privilege escalation vulnerability

Published: Jun 25, 2021Updated: Nov 21, 2024 Sources: CVE List NVDCWE-710

Description

In Weidmueller Industrial WLAN devices in multiple versions an exploitable privilege escalation vulnerability exists in the iw_console functionality. A specially crafted menu selection string can cause an escape from the restricted console, resulting in system access as the root user. An attacker can send commands while authenticated as a low privilege user to trigger this vulnerability.
